Deals Gap (el. 1,988 ft (606 m)) is a mountain pass along the North Carolina–Tennessee state line, bordering the Great Smoky Mountains National Park and near the Little Tennessee River. At 0.7 miles (1.1 km) south of the gap is the unincorporated community that shares the same name, located at the intersection of US 129 and NC 28 .
Drexel's first basketball game was played against Temple College on November 22, 1894, which Drexel won by a score of 26–1. [2] [3] The Dragons joined Division I in 1974. Drexel has received bids to five NCAA basketball tournaments in 1986, 1994, 1995, 1996, and 2021. During the 1996 tournament, Malik Rose led the team to their only second ...

The 1968–69 Drexel Dragons men's basketball team represented Drexel Institute of Technology during the 1968–69 men's basketball season. The Dragons, led by 1st year head coach Frank Szymanski, played their home games at Sayre High School and were members of the Middle Atlantic Conferences (MAC). The team finished the season 8–11.
